Imaging Tool Developer Job Description

At Canfield Scientific, Inc., we are seeking a skilled Imaging Tool Developer to join our team. As a key member of our development team, you will be responsible for creating and testing production tools for performance/stress testing on equipment hardware using C/C++.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Create and test production tools for performance/stress testing on equipment hardware using C/C++
  • Perform software and hardware systems test and debugging on image capture applications
  • Collaborate with development teams when Tier-2 issues arise with debugging/testing
  • Provide training and technical support on the testing tools post development for production use
  • Create documentation for the testing tools designed, including presentations on use of for end users
  • Refine our underlying data capture system and algorithms to improve the user experience utilizing C/C++

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ree preferably in computer science, machine vision, engineering, or a related field
  • 3 years of experience in software tool development for hardware testing using C/C++
  • Experience in coding imaging processing, machine vision algorithms
  • Demonstrated knowledge with installing/configuring Windows/Mac on a PC/Hardware and mobile device
  • Strong presentation and training skills, both for technical and non-technical topics

Desired Qualifications:

  • Knowledge of Linux and/or shell scripts
  • Experience with repository tools like Git, Subversion, Surround
